Where police data is processed by special investigating officers, the Municipal Executive acts as the data controller.<\/p>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t  <\/div>\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-item\">\n\t\t\t  <h2 class=\"accordion-header\" id=\"heading-u1-i2\">\n\t\t\t\t<button class=\"accordion-button collapsed\" type=\"button\" data-bs-toggle=\"collapse\" data-bs-target=\"#collapse-u1-i2\" aria-expanded=\"false\" aria-controls=\"collapse-u1-i2\">\n\t\t\t\t  <span class=\"accordion-toggle\"><\/span>Who are the special investigating officers for the municipality of Apeldoorn?\t\t\t\t<\/button>\n\t\t\t  <\/h2>\n\t\t\t  <div id=\"collapse-u1-i2\" class=\"accordion-collapse collapse\" aria-labelledby=\"heading-u1-i2\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-body\">\n\t\t\t\t  <p>The municipality of Apeldoorn employs a number of special investigating officers: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Community support officers in public spaces. They monitor compliance with, amongst other things, the General Local Regulation (APV). Think, for example, of the enforcement officers on the streets.<\/li>\n<li>Compulsory Education Officers. They monitor compliance with the Compulsory Education Act. This includes issues such as truancy.<\/li>\n<li>Social investigators. Their work includes, for example, investigating benefit fraud with the aim of combating fraud relating to employment and income.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>The special investigating officers are divided into a number of so-called \u2018domains\u2019. At Apeldoorn Council, these are Domains I and II (Public Spaces and the Environment), Domain III (Compulsory Education Officers) and Domain V (Social Investigators).<\/p>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t  <\/div>\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-item\">\n\t\t\t  <h2 class=\"accordion-header\" id=\"heading-u1-i3\">\n\t\t\t\t<button class=\"accordion-button collapsed\" type=\"button\" data-bs-toggle=\"collapse\" data-bs-target=\"#collapse-u1-i3\" aria-expanded=\"false\" aria-controls=\"collapse-u1-i3\">\n\t\t\t\t  <span class=\"accordion-toggle\"><\/span>Why do we process police data?\t\t\t\t<\/button>\n\t\t\t  <\/h2>\n\t\t\t  <div id=\"collapse-u1-i3\" class=\"accordion-collapse collapse\" aria-labelledby=\"heading-u1-i3\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-body\">\n\t\t\t\t  <p>The local authority only processes police data where there is a legal basis for doing so. On the <a class=\"external external link\" href=\"https:\/\/www.autoriteitpersoonsgegevens.nl\/themas\/internationaal\/doorgifte-binnen-en-buiten-de-eer\">the Dutch Data Protection Authority\u2019s website<\/a> You can find more information about this there.<\/p>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t  <\/div>\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-item\">\n\t\t\t  <h2 class=\"accordion-header\" id=\"heading-u1-i6\">\n\t\t\t\t<button class=\"accordion-button collapsed\" type=\"button\" data-bs-toggle=\"collapse\" data-bs-target=\"#collapse-u1-i6\" aria-expanded=\"false\" aria-controls=\"collapse-u1-i6\">\n\t\t\t\t  <span class=\"accordion-toggle\"><\/span>How long do we keep police records?\t\t\t\t<\/button>\n\t\t\t  <\/h2>\n\t\t\t  <div id=\"collapse-u1-i6\" class=\"accordion-collapse collapse\" aria-labelledby=\"heading-u1-i6\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-body\">\n\t\t\t\t  <p>The Police Data Act sets out specific rules on how long we are permitted to retain police data. The Act specifies time limits for how long police data may be retained. Once this time limit has been reached, the personal data must be permanently deleted. We must, in any case, comply with two different retention periods. Which one we must apply depends on whether a special investigating officer (BOA) carries out day-to-day police duties or is involved in longer-term investigations, such as a social investigator. We explain this below.<\/p>\n<p>The retention period for police data processed for day-to-day policing duties \u2013 for example, for issuing fines \u2013 is as follows. During the first year after a special investigating officer (BOA) first processes police data, this data is widely accessible to BOAs where necessary for the performance of their duties. In the four years that follow, police data may only be accessed via targeted searches, for example by registration number or name. Finally, police data is retained for a further five years. During this final phase, the data may only be used for purposes such as handling complaints or conducting audits. After this final period, the data is destroyed.<\/p>\n<p>The retention period for police data processed in the context of targeted investigations, for example by social investigators, is as follows. For targeted investigations, police data may be processed for as long as is necessary to achieve the purpose of the investigation. The purpose may, for example, be deemed to have been achieved once a court has finally handed down a judgement. After that, information from an investigation may still be reused for a further six months. An official within the local authority oversees this process. Finally, police data is retained for a further five years. During this final phase, the data may only be used for purposes such as handling complaints or conducting audits. During this phase, the Public Prosecution Service may, for example, still request the information. This only occurs in exceptional cases. Once these five years have elapsed, the data is destroyed.<\/p>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t  <\/div>\n\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-item\">\n\t\t\t  <h2 class=\"accordion-header\" id=\"heading-u1-i7\">\n\t\t\t\t<button class=\"accordion-button collapsed\" type=\"button\" data-bs-toggle=\"collapse\" data-bs-target=\"#collapse-u1-i7\" aria-expanded=\"false\" aria-controls=\"collapse-u1-i7\">\n\t\t\t\t  <span class=\"accordion-toggle\"><\/span>What privacy rights do data subjects have?\t\t\t\t<\/button>\n\t\t\t  <\/h2>\n\t\t\t  <div id=\"collapse-u1-i7\" class=\"accordion-collapse collapse\" aria-labelledby=\"heading-u1-i7\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"accordion-body\">\n\t\t\t\t  <p>Whenever we process your police records, we will inform you of the reasons for doing so.
